YMCA STUDENTS TO WALK FOR CHARITY

11:33am Thursday 11th March 2010

By Carol Ann Walters - community correspondent

18-year-old student Elise Phillips from Erith, Kent is walking from Greenwich Park to Bexleyheath Shopping Centre on Wednesday 17 March to raise money for Greenwich & Bexley Cottage Hospice.

Elise, who is on a 10-week work-based learning course at The Howbury Centre, Erith is learning all about the work place and as one of her projects she is required to fundraise for a fun day out.

Elise said: "We thought a good way of raising money for our day out was to do a sponsored walk. We chose to support Greenwich & Bexley Cottage Hospice because it's a local charity that's close to our hearts."

Elise will be walking with 18-year-old Kerri Morss from Erith and 17-year-old Kirstie Oake from Erith to raise money for charity, with 50% of the funds raised going to Greenwich & Bexley Hospice and the rest going to a fun day out for the young people of the Greenwich YMCA group.

The students hope to raise at least £100.
